Use the given conditions to find the exact values of sin(2u), cos(2u), and tan(2u) using the double-angle formulas.
sin(u) = -3/5, 3π/2 < u < 2π
sin(2u) =
cos(2u) =
tan(2u)

Answers

Answer:

[tex]\sin(2u)=-\dfrac{24}{25}[/tex]

[tex]\cos(2u)=\dfrac{7}{25}[/tex]

[tex]\tan(2u)=-\dfrac{24}{7}[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

Given sin(u) = -3/5, use the trigonometric identity sin²θ + cos²θ = 1 to find cos(u):

[tex]\begin{aligned}\sin^2(u)+\cos^2(u)&=1\\\\\left(-\dfrac{3}{5}\right)^2+\cos^2(u)&=1\\\\\dfrac{9}{25}+\cos^2(u)&=1\\\\\cos^2(u)&=1-\dfrac{9}{25}\\\\\cos^2(u)&=\dfrac{16}{25}\\\\\cos(u)&=\dfrac{4}{5}\end{aligned}[/tex]

As u is in the interval 3π/2 < u < 2π, the angle is in quadrant IV of the unit circle. In quadrant IV, cos is positive and sin is negative. Therefore:

[tex]\sin(u)=-\dfrac{3}{5} \qquad \cos(u)=\dfrac{4}{5}[/tex]

Calculate tan(u) by using the identity tanθ = sinθ/cosθ:

[tex]\tan(u)=\dfrac{-\frac{3}{5}}{\frac{4}{5}}=-\dfrac{3}{4}[/tex]

[tex]\boxed{\begin{minipage}{5 cm}\underline{Double Angle Identities}\\\\$\sin (2\theta)=2\sin \theta \cos \theta $\\\\$\cos (2\theta)=\cos^2\theta-\sin^2\theta$\\\\$\tan (2\theta)=\dfrac{2\tan\theta}{1 -\tan^2\theta}$\\\end{minipage}}[/tex]

Use the double angle identities to find sin(2u), cos(2u) and tan(2u).

[tex]\hrulefill[/tex]

[tex]\begin{aligned}\sin (2u)&=2\sin u \cos u\\\\&=2\left(-\dfrac{3}{5}\right) \left(\dfrac{4}{5}\right)\\\\&=-\dfrac{24}{25}\end{aligned}[/tex]

[tex]\hrulefill[/tex]

[tex]\begin{aligned}\cos (2u)&=\cos^2u - \sin^2u\\\\&=\left(\dfrac{4}{5}\right)^2-\left(-\dfrac{3}{5}\right)^2\\\\&=\dfrac{16}{25}-\dfrac{9}{25}\\\\&=\dfrac{7}{25}\end{aligned}[/tex]

[tex]\hrulefill[/tex]

[tex]\begin{aligned}\tan (2u)&=\dfrac{2\tan(u)}{1 -\tan^2(u)}\\\\&=\dfrac{2\left(-\frac{3}{4}\right)}{1 -\left(-\frac{3}{4}\right)^2}\\\\&=\dfrac{-\frac{3}{2}}{1 -\frac{9}{16}}\\\\&=\dfrac{-\frac{3}{2}}{\frac{7}{16}}\\\\&=-\dfrac{3}{2} \cdot \dfrac{16}{7}\\\\&=-\dfrac{48}{14}\\\\&=-\dfrac{48\div2}{14\div2}\\\\&=-\dfrac{24}{7}\end{aligned}[/tex]

A survey of nonprofit organizations showed that online fundraising has increased in the past year. You want to estimate the population mean one-time gift donation. Based on a random sample of 55 nonprofits, the mean of one-time gift donation is $125. The value $125 is:________.
a. an interval estimate
b. a statistic
c. a parameter
d. a confidence interval
e. a point estimate

Answers

Answer:

e. a point estimate

Step-by-step explanation:

When an estimate for the unknown population parameter is expressed by a single value it is called a point estimate.

Example : If we wish to find the height of a very large group of students on the basis of a sample and we find it to be 64 inches. 64 inches is the point estimate.

Similarly the value given is the point estimate.

Point estimate of the population parameter provides as an estimate a single value calculated from the sample that is likely to be close in value to the unknown parameter. It is to be noted that a point estimate will not in general be equal to the population parameter as the random sample used is one of the many possible samples which could be chosen from the population.

One semester in a chemistry class, 14 students failed due to poor attendance, 23 failed due to not studying, 15 failed because they did not turn in assignments, 9 failed because of poor attendance and not studying, 8 failed because of not studying and not turning in assignments, 5 failed because of poor attendance and not turning in assignments, and 2 failed because of all three of these reasons.

Required:
a. How many failed for exactly two of the three reasons?
b. How many failed because of poor attendance and not studying but not because of not turning in assignments?
c. How many failed because of exactly one of the three reasons?
d. How many failed because of poor attendance and not turning in assignments but not because of not studying?

Answers

Answer:

(a) 16 students failed for exactly two of the three reasons.

(b) 7 students failed because of poor attendance and not studying but not because of not turning in assignments.

(c) 14 students failed because of exactly one of the three reasons.

(d) 3 students failed because of poor attendance and not turning in assignments but not because of not studying.

Step-by-step explanation:

We are given that one semester in a chemistry class, 14 students failed due to poor attendance, 23 failed due to not studying, 15 failed because they did not turn in assignments, 9 failed because of poor attendance and not studying, 8 failed because of not studying and not turning in assignments, 5 failed because of poor attendance and not turning in assignments, and 2 failed because of all three of these reasons.

As shown in the diagram attached below, a Venn diagram represents the situation given in the question;

In the diagram below, 2 in represents purple color represents the number of students failed because of all three of these reasons.

7 represents the number of students who failed because of poor attendance and not studying but not due to not turning in assignments.

6 represents the number of students who failed because of not studying and not turning in assignments but not due to poor attendance.

3 represents the number of students who failed because of poor attendance and not turning in assignments but not due to not studying.

2 in red color represents the number of students who failed only due to poor attendance.

8 in red color represents the number of students who failed only due to not studying.

4 in red color represents the number of students who failed only due to not turning in assignments.

(a) The number of students who failed because of exactly two of the three reasons = 7 + 6 + 3 = 16 students.

(b) The number of students who failed because of poor attendance and not studying but not because of not turning in assignments = 9 - 2 = 7 students.

(c) The number of students who failed because of exactly one of the three reasons = 2 + 8 + 4 = 14 students.

(d) The number of students who failed because of poor attendance and not turning in assignments but not because of not studying = 5 - 2 = 3 students.
